Introduction
Leading home services provider in USA with 23 brands, 40 territories, and 4000 franchises needed a state of the art E2E Single Point of Sale system for franchises, brands, and customers.

Consolidate all Point-Of-Sale systems into a single codebase
Should fulfill all 23 brand needs
Omni Channel interactions for customers
Payment Orchestration

Manage requirements from different Brand Owners
Complex integrations with existing systems and third-party software
Multi-vendor engagement with varying priorities

Discovery phase to create architecture blueprint
Agile scaled framework with 2-week sprints and constant architecture runway
Cloud Native architecture with event-driven paradigm and managed services
Numerous independently deployable microservices with mobile apps and SPA
Technological Framework

Why these Setup?
.NET Core microservices with React Native hybrid apps deliver a unified codebase that serves all 23 brands eliminating per-brand development overhead while supporting brand-specific customisation through configuration.

Why this Setup?
Event-driven architecture on AWS with Terraform IaC ensures consistent, repeatable deployments across all 4000 franchise locations, while CloudFront CDN delivers fast, reliable POS performance regardless of location.

Why this Setup?
A unified payment orchestration layer with brand-specific configuration connectors allows the single POS codebase to behave differently for each of the 23 brands without separate codebases or deployment pipelines.
